FANTALEO GIDIONI VS REPUBLIC

FANTALEO GIDIONI VS REPUBLIC

The conviction was quashed because the prosecution failed to prove the offence of incest by male beyond reasonable doubt due to material contradictions in the evidence, variance between the charge and the evidence, and lack of proof of sexual intercourse.

  1. 1 Whether the prosecution proved the offence of incest by male beyond reasonable doubt
  2. 2 Whether variance between the charge and evidence vitiated the conviction
  3. 3 Whether contradictions and discrepancies in prosecution evidence undermined the case

Ratio Decidendi

The conviction was quashed because the prosecution failed to prove the offence of incest by male beyond reasonable doubt due to material contradictions in the evidence, variance between the charge and the evidence, and lack of proof of sexual intercourse.

Court Disposition

appeal allowed

Orders

  • conviction quashed
  • sentence set aside
